Neuware -This book provides the background needed to understand not only the wide field of polymer processing, but also the emerging technologies associated with the plastics industry in the 21st century. It combines practical engineering concepts with modeling of realistic polymer processes. Divided into three sections, it provides the reader with a solid knowledge base in polymer materials, polymer processing, and modeling.'Understanding Polymer Processing' is intended for the person who is entering the plastics manufacturing industry and as a textbook for students taking an introductory course in polymer processing. It also serves as a guide to the practicing engineer when choosing a process, determining important parameters and factors during the early stages of process design, and when optimizing such a process. Practical examples illustrating basic concepts are presented throughout the book.New in the third edition are chapters on data-driven modeling and physics-driven modeling, as well as new sections on manufacturing and dimensional analysis. In addition to a number of other smaller improvements and corrections throughout the book, bonus code downloads are also provided. Contents: Part I: Polymeric MaterialsThis section gives a general introduction to polymers, including mechanical behavior of polymers and melt rheology.Part II: Polymer ProcessingThe major polymer processes are introduced in this section, including extrusion, mixing, injection molding, thermoforming, blow molding, film blowing, and many others.Part III: ModelingThis last section delivers the tools to allow the engineer to solve back-of-the-envelope polymer processing models.
